Buildings

\n*British Library in London, designed by Colin St John Wilson opens.\n* Commerzbank Tower in Frankfurt, designed by Norman Foster is completed.\n*Getty Center in Los Angeles, designed by Richard Meier.\n*Guggenheim Museum Bilbao, designed by Frank Gehry opens to the public.\n*Petronas Twin Towers in Kuala Lumpar, designed by Cesar Pelli, become the tallest building in the world.

Awards

\n*
Pritzker Prize - Sverre Fehn\n*Stirling Prize - Michael Wilford, Stuttgart Music School
